Wildfires have prompted hospitalizations and evacuations across Europe, with England, France, Greece, and Croatia battling blazes. In Stourbridge, West Midlands, four individuals, including a child, were taken to the hospital following fires in the area. The situation led to the evacuation of 500 people in southwest France.

Emergency services are working under challenging conditions to combat the fires. West Midlands Mayor Richard Parker is in contact with local leaders and emergency responders. Prime Minister Rishi Sunak expressed his thoughts for those affected, acknowledging the bravery of firefighters who are putting themselves at risk.

"Our firefighters are working in incredibly difficult conditions and putting themselves at risk to keep others safe," Sunak stated. "A huge thank you to them and everyone supporting the effort tonight." He urged the public to stay safe and follow the advice of emergency services.
